All firearm purchases at Summit Firearms are conducted in full compliance with federal and Indiana state law, including ATF Form 4473 and a NICS background check for every firearm sale. Indiana follows all applicable federal regulations governing the purchase and transfer of firearms and related products.
Ammunition purchases in Indiana do not require a background check or special permit for adults who are legally permitted to possess firearms and ammunition. Indiana enacted constitutional carry in 2022, meaning law-abiding residents who are legally permitted to possess a firearm may carry it openly or concealed without a state-issued permit. Residents who travel out of state or want reciprocity recognition in other jurisdictions can obtain an optional Indiana License to Carry Handgun through their local law enforcement agency. Hollow point and defensive ammunition are legal to purchase and possess in Indiana for eligible residents.
Indiana hunters should consult the Indiana DNR for current regulations on legal ammunition types for specific game seasons, including non-toxic shot requirements for waterfowl hunting and any zone-specific rules for deer season. No, Indiana does not require a permit or background check specifically for ammunition purchases. Adults who are legally permitted to possess firearms and ammunition may purchase ammo without a special license. A valid government-issued ID confirming age may be requested at the point of sale. All firearm purchases from a licensed dealer require a background check, but ammunition purchases are not subject to those requirements.
Modern hollow point ammunition from quality manufacturers is widely considered the best choice for defensive handgun use, as it expands on impact to deliver more energy to the target while reducing the risk of over-penetration. Popular defensive calibers include 9mm, .40 S&W, and .45 ACP, all available in proven hollow point loads. The best choice depends on your specific handgun model and your ability to control the firearm accurately under stress. Federal law requires non-toxic shot for all migratory waterfowl hunting nationwide, including in Indiana. Steel shot is the most widely used and affordable non-toxic option, while bismuth and tungsten loads offer better downrange performance at a higher price. Indiana waterfowl hunters should always use a choke rated for steel shot and verify current Indiana DNR regulations for zone-specific requirements and season dates before heading to the blind.
For Indiana pheasant hunting, most hunters reach for 12 or 20 gauge shells loaded with #4, #5, or #6 lead shot in 2 3/4- or 3-inch lengths. High-velocity field loads give you clean kills at typical flushing distances across Northeast Indiana’s agricultural cover. Lead shot is legal for upland game hunting in Indiana. Always check current Indiana DNR season dates and bag limits before heading afield.
Indiana allows centerfire rifles for deer hunting statewide, making bolt action rifles in popular calibers such as .308 Winchester, .30-06 Springfield, 6.5 Creedmoor, .243 Winchester, and .270 Winchester strong choices for Indiana whitetail hunters. Straight-wall cartridge options such as .350 Legend, .450 Bushmaster, and .45-70 Government are also popular, particularly in areas with straight-wall traditions. Always verify current Indiana DNR regulations for your specific zone and season before purchasing hunting ammunition.

Ammunition should be stored in a cool, dry location away from heat, moisture, and direct sunlight, which can degrade propellants and primers over time. Quality ammo storage containers and cans protect rounds from humidity and keep your supply organized for quick access. Storing ammunition securely alongside locked firearms is a recommended best practice, particularly in households with children.
